About this listen

What if reality is not something you simply witness—but something you actively refract?

In Refractions of the Real: A Manual for Self-Directed Beings, philosopher Kevin L. Michel invites you to step beyond passive “truth-seeking” and master the hidden prism of perception that colors every moment of your life. Blending Stoic clarity, Hermetic principles, and flashes of Nietzschean insight, Michel shows how the light of the world and the lens of the mind together create the spectrum we call “reality.”

Inside, you’ll discover how to:
  • See through first impressions – train the eye behind the eye and dissolve the biases that hijack daily judgment.

  • Rewrite the inner narrative – turn the “fiction that writes itself” into a conscious script of growth and possibility.

  • Aim desire like a laser – align wants with core values so they attract opportunity instead of anxiety.

  • Speak spells, not sentences – wield language as a creative wand that uplifts yourself and others.

  • Surf life’s pendulum – ride emotional and energetic rhythms without being dragged by them.

  • Anchor in witness consciousness – become the frame that holds every picture, unshaken by success or setback.

  • Embrace refracted enlightenment – find freedom not in escaping illusion, but in dancing with it wisely.

Each chapter pairs poetic reflection with practical exercises—brief “field drills” that turn philosophy into embodied habit before the day is out.
